What is a good first car to modify?

Mazda Miata This is because the Mazda Miata is such a simple car with a ton of character. The Miata is a lightweight RWD platform that is perfect for anyone looking to get into entry-level motorsports. Being that the Miata is so light, any modification you do will most likely make a noticeable difference.

  • What was the fastest car made in 2006?

    2006 Bugatti Veyron —
    The head of the fastest car class of 2006 is the 2006 Bugatti Veyron — an extreme machine with a top speed of more than 250 mph — which rockets from zero to 60 mph in 2.5 seconds. It tops our Top 10 Fastest Cars list, which is based on quickest acceleration times.
